I hope Ford is on a contract until the end of the season - too old and too slow for SL next year, which is why he's signed for Featherstone. Nobody in SL wanted him for this year, and next year he'll be even older.

Featherstone can sign as many players as they like, but its all going to come down to a one-off game against Leigh.

If they have an off-day that day - which can easily happen to any team - they won't get the promotion slot.

Of course, the same applies to Leigh!

One of those two teams will be looking at staying in the Championship with a bloated over-priced squad that they cannot really afford. The promoted team will have to offload most of their players as well because there is no way either squad will survive at Super League level.

This is what happens when you have promotion and relegation between an elite professional league and a largely part-time league.

Im going to disagree with a lot of that. The worrying thing for the other teams in our league is that whichever team does not go up can almost certainly afford to run a similar standard of squad next year, Leigh because of Beaumont willing to pump money in to the club and Fev because they have income streams that far outweigh every team in this league and a few teams in SL. Regards to the squads when they go up, I think Fev have the best chance of staying up although at this point I feel they are a little behind Leigh in the race for that spot in SL but if they were to go up I think they will end up keeping the majority of their squad and with a few good editions should be able to keep their place the following year. If you want to compare then they are a little bit like Hull Kr when they were in our division and they built year on year to get to this point. Leigh on the other hand are likely to lose a lot of players, firstly because of the quota rules and secondly I would imagine because a lot of their players signed 1 year contracts which looks like a chance to put themselves in the shop window and with squad rotations like leigh have every year there will be very little loyalty and most of their players will be out for what they can get which is why I think Fev have the upper hand in that respect.

Well, Fev fans keep telling us a lot of their squad are part-time. I'm not so sure myself, but if they are right then those players are either going to have to go full-time or leave, since SL rules require a full-time squad. They've also got quite a few older players, although McDermott seems to be phasing them out.

So I think they would need a good bit of squad turnover. I agree that they have good income streams, so that's a positive.

As for Leigh, well, who can predict what Beaumont will do? He has previous with spitting his dummy.

You can actually check the Twitter bios of some of Fev's part-time players and they tell you their job (James Lockwood and John Davies are 2 examples). Fev have a mixture of players who have jobs outside rugby and players who don't, but none of them are in full-time training - they train (I think) 3 evenings per week and Brian McDermott made it clear in an interview this week that he wishes the club was full time.

Can you point me to the RFL rule that say SL rules require a full-time squad? They must have changed fairly recently, because in 2019 Davide Longo was suggesting the club would remain part-time, or at least remain a hybrid team, if promoted.
